There are a few requirements you must do before you can obtain your license in New York.


The written test is the first step. This is a 20-question exam that covers New York's traffic laws and road signs. To pass you must complete at least 14 of the questions correctly. Learn the NYS Driver's Manual, and take practice tests to prepare. Practice tests are available on the internet or at your local DMV.

Once you have passed the written exam and passed the written exam, you are able to schedule an examination on the road. This is a driving test that will be administered by an examiner at your DMV office. The examiner will test your ability to drive safely and observe traffic laws by observing your driving abilities in a road that is public. To prepare for the road test, you must study the New York State Driver's Manual and practice driving with a partner or family member.

Once you've successfully completed your road test you will receive your New York driver's license in the mail. The process may take a bit of time but once you're licensed, you are free to enjoy the benefits of driving yourself whenever and wherever you want.

How do I apply for an driver's license in New York?

There are a number of steps you must follow to obtain your New York driver's licence. These include registering at the local DMV office taking the written knowledge test and a vision test, and taking a road test. To pass these tests, you will have to answer at a minimum 14 of the 20 questions correctly. You can prepare for the test online before you go to the DMV and the state provides the road test free study guide. The road test is a driving test that you can do hands-on, and you will need to prove that you are able to safely drive on New York streets and roads.

Bring all the documents you need with you when you visit the DMV. You'll need to provide evidence of your identity such as your birth date and gender, as well as the consent that was signed by your guardians or parents (if you're under 18 years old). You must provide evidence that you live in New York. This can be accomplished by submitting a variety of documents, such as pay statements, utility bills, Social Security statements, postmarked mail, property deeds or lease agreements, and much more. You can see a full list of acceptable documents in this useful DMV document guide.

You can exchange your current photo driver's license from another U.S. or Canadian province at the DMV. You must provide a copy of your driver's license issued outside of the state along with a photo and a certified driving record from the state that issued it. If you don't have a valid Social Security number, you must provide an affidavit of no Social Security Number with your application.

Once you have completed all the required steps, you will be able to schedule your road test. It is recommended that you practice a lot before the test, and that you be at minimum 16 years old prior to scheduling it. Once you've passed your road test, you will receive your official New York driver's license in the mail.

The first step is to obtain your learners permit. This is a requirement for the road test, and it requires you to pass a written test on New York State Driver's Manual driving laws. You must also pass an eye test. It is essential to bring your glasses or contacts with you to the DMV, so that you are able to pass the test.

After you have obtained your learners permit, you must be driving under the supervision of an experienced adult. This includes daytime and evening driving. You must complete a minimum of 50 hours of controlled driving before you can pass your road test. You might want to consider taking a defensive-driving course to improve your driving skills and save money on insurance.

If you are under 18 years old, you'll have to comply with the Graduated Driver License law, which places restrictions on new drivers until they reach the age of 18. Once you've successfully completed this process, you can apply for your standard driver's license (Class D).
